Don Edwin Ketelsen, 70, of DeWitt, Iowa, died Thursday morning, December 1, 2016, in the comfort of his home surrounded by his loved ones.
He was born June 5, 1946, in Clinton to Arlo and Velma (Fallesen) Ketelsen. Don graduated from Northeast High School where he wrote the fight song which is still used today. Don went on to further his studies at the University of Northern Iowa, receiving a Bachelor's Degree. He began his teaching career and was teaching at Bennett when he was called to serve in the Army during the Vietnam War. Following his military service he returned to teaching English at Bennett and later Calamus Wheatland. Don later received a Master's Degree from the University of Iowa. Don retired from teaching in 2002, but remained active with various jobs around DeWitt. He was united in marriage to Kathy Kaczinski on May 25, 1991, at Grace Lutheran Church, DeWitt by the Rev. Ronald Goodsman.
He was a member of Grace Lutheran Church, DeWitt where he directed and was active in the choir and also assisted at Grace Camp activities. Don was involved for many years in the Ol' Majestic Players where he both acted in and directed plays. He also was a member of the Village Voices in DeWitt. Don loved reading and gardening. Above all, he found great joy as a loving husband, father and grandfather.
Surviving are his wife, Kathy; children, Brandon Ketelsen of DeWitt and Kaitlyn (Chad) Giebelstein of Bennett; step-children, Kellie (Ralph) Hillis of Bettendorf and James (Davinna) Kaczinski of West Melborne, Florida; grandchildren, Brendan, Kilie and Carver Hillis and Maddox and Dillan Kaczinski; his mother, Velma Ketelsen of Fulton, Illinois; siblings, Arla Rae (Fran) McMahon of Charlotte, Aletha (Kenny) Roeder of Fulton, Becky (Larry) Musel of Clinton, Keith (Lyn) Ketelsen of Milan, Illinois, Robb (Lori) Ketelsen of Osco, Illinois, and Annie (Tim) Fischer of Bellevue; his father-in-law, William (Judy Saylor) Kelly; many nieces and nephews.
Preceding Don in death were his father, Arlo and his mother-in-law, Darleen Kelly.
